General: Daniel Knyss takes the lead

June 16, 2014 by the editorial office

merkur

The trip of our Merkur Cycling Team to the Schleizer Dreieck Everyone-bike race. Although Daniel was not able to repeat his victory from last year, he was still able to put on the yellow jersey of the overall leader in the German Cycling Cup after the race. At the same time, we defended our top position in the ranking of the best teams.

Florian Vrecko from Team Strassacker secured the day's victory in East Thuringia, bringing a comfortable lead of more than one and a half minutes to the finish. In the sprint for second place, Daniel had to give way to his competitor Marek Bosniatzki (Bürstner Dümo). Christian Dengler and Friedrich Schweizer rounded off the good performance of the Merkur Cycling Team on the Schleizer Dreieck with ranks nine and ten.



“The day's result wasn't the focus for us today. We wanted to gain points in the battle for the team and individual rankings and extend our lead. We succeeded", Daniel commented on the race day's results. "The next races will be exciting and we're looking forward to our next appearance at the German Professional Championships in Baunatal."

"The Merkur Cycling Team is getting better and better", our main sponsor Markus Adam was delighted. “We are facing eventful races in the fight for overall victory in the German Cycling Cup. All teams are almost level and will not sacrifice anything.”

There isn't much time to rest. In just two weeks, we will meet the top teams of the German amateur scene at the seventh race in the German Cycling Cup as part of the German Professional Championships in Baunatal in Hesse.



Meanwhile, the outcome of the sixth race guarantees more excitement in the fight for the German amateur championship. Daniel was able to regain the yellow jersey of the overall leader and at the same time leads in the Masters 1 age group. The two-time winner of the season is now 23 points ahead of Sandro Kühmel (Bürstner-Dümo / 2.018) and has a total of 1.995 points. Kühmel's teammate Marek Bosniatzki (1.983) follows in third place and our Merkur Druck driver Stefan Räth (1.962) in fourth.

Friedrich Schweizer, Christian Dengler and Till Baltes are in sixth to eighth place in the top ten and within striking distance of the top ten, and veteran Bernd Weinhold is consolidating his lead with twelfth place overall, ahead of his teammate Manfred Böhm in his Master 3 age group.

With Stefan Räth, Friedrich Schweizer and Till Baltes, three drivers from our team are in the lead in the main class. In addition, Christine Göldner defended her top position in her Masters 3 age group. In the overall individual ranking, the only female rider in the Merkur Cycling Team is fourth.



In the ranking of the best teams in the German Cycling Cup, we lead ahead of Team Bürstner Dümo and the Lock8 Cycling Team.
